This book is a continuation of the first text entitled "Pyrrhic Victory: The Cost of Integration". It focuses on identifying solutions to the issues addressed in the previous book and takes a cohesive and empathic approach to dealing with Black issues and issues affecting all minorities. The provocative text brings to life the quote "Before You Remove The Knife" and examines the knife, the person or group who placed it in the wound, and the person or group responsible for removing it and healing the damaged and infected area. It allows readers to travel back in time to reevaluate slavery, Jim Crow, and other significant moments that have created the current movement in the Black community. This book uses theoretical concepts to solve some of the problems in society, but most importantly, it brings awareness to our youth and supplies readers with alternatives if their request for equity is not met and the peace and pieces are not provided to complete their historical puzzle.
